Here’s a mistake I have seen lots of CSET test takers make in my more than 10 years of helping people pass the CSET…
In a vacuum, in space, or on the surface of the Moon where there is no air resistance, when two things are dropped they both hit the ground at the same time; however, Earth is not a vacuum, there is air resistance.
